- #5 – We will continue to enhance our unified communications solution with an increased focus on the end user
Why do so many of us have to pick up our phones to send a text message when we are working on our laptops? Why must we use special devices for video calling? Why must we dial into retrieve voice mail? Users in the New Year will not only want, but expect, a unified experience across all of their real-time communication services. As an industry, we have been developing the standards and technology that supports a powerful shift in integrated communication services. So what does this look like?
- Users install applications on their many devices and these devices then register with their cloud communication services.
- These applications ensure a seamless experience across the devices, so that users can establish service from that device.
- The applications provide access to a full range of services including video calling, conferencing, voice mail, text messaging, collaboration, chat and presence.
Service providers in the New Year have the unique opportunity to bring together a rich set of real-time communications services along with the power of social networks, providing a true unified communications experience. Service providers who can take advantage of seamless services will capture this market, while end users will benefit from the freedom to use the right device at the right time for work or pleasure.
